About Trident Galleries
Trident Galleries, located in the heart of Leicester in the East Midlands, is a vibrant art space dedicated to showcasing a diverse range of contemporary and modern artworks. Founded in 2010 by renowned curator and art advocate, Jane Doe, the gallery has made a name for itself by focusing on emerging artists as well as established figures in the art world.
The gallery is known for its eclectic exhibitions that often blend different mediums, including painting, sculpture, photography, and digital art. Trident Galleries aims to provide a platform for artists to engage with the community and promote dialogue around contemporary issues through art. The mission of the gallery is to cultivate creativity and inspire both local and international audiences through provocative exhibitions and educational programs.
Trident Galleries has hosted solo shows for artists such as Emily Jones, a contemporary painter known for her vibrant use of color, and Tom Smith, a sculptor who creates striking pieces from recycled materials. The gallery also collaborates with local schools and universities to promote art education and support young artists in their creative endeavors.
The target audience includes art collectors, students, and anyone with an interest in contemporary art. Trident Galleries is committed to accessibility and regularly holds free community events, artist talks, and workshops, drawing in art lovers and casual visitors alike.
Interesting facts about Trident Galleries include their annual art fair, which showcases up-and-coming artists from the East Midlands and beyond, as well as their commitment to sustainable practices by exhibiting eco-friendly art. Located in a historic building that dates back over a century, the gallery perfectly marries the old with the new, creating a unique atmosphere that delights every visitor.
